Thomas Ray "T. J." Shope Jr. (born August 12, 1985) is a Republican politician and grocery store operator who serves in the Arizona House of Representatives from the 8th Legislative District. He was first elected to the state House in 2012 and represents central & eastern Pinal County and southern Gila County. He was re-elected to a second term in 2014. In 2016, he was re-elected to his third term and was appointed Speaker Pro Tempore of the House in January 2017.

Shope was born in Florence, Arizona to Thomas "Tom" Shope, Sr., and Luz Shope. Tom is the Mayor of the City of Coolidge and owner of an independent grocer. He attended Coolidge High School where he graduated in 2003, and went on to attend Central Arizona College for two years, graduating in 2005, before transferring to Arizona State University where he earned a Bachelor of Science degree in Political Science in 2008.

While in college, Shope was an active political participant, and served as the President of the ASU College Republicans, and later as the State Chairman of the Arizona Federation of College Republicans. Shope was also an active athletic group leader and served as a founding member of the board of directors of Arizona State University's Student Sun Devil Club. Shope also worked for Arizona State University's Disability Resource Center and as a columnist for the State Press newspaper at Arizona State while attending school there.

Shope began his political career when in 2008 he was elected to the Coolidge Unified School District Governing Board, and voted to be the board's Vice President upon taking office. In 2013, he was elected President of the Governing Board.

After serving one full term on the school board, Shope announced his candidacy in 2012 for the state House from the newly drawn 8th Legislative District, which encompasses the cities & towns of Coolidge, Florence, Casa Grande, Eloy, Mammoth, Hayden, Winkleman, Kearny, Globe, and Miami. He also represents the vast unincorporated community of San Tan Valley as well as the Gila River Indian Community. Shope ran on a ticket with incumbent representative Frank Pratt, and both were unopposed in the Primary Election. In the General Election, Shope received the second highest amount of votes at 25% (Pratt receiving the most), thereby defeating the two Democratic candidates, and winning one of the two seats for the 8th district, alongside Pratt.
